Network Redundancy Vs Resiliency What S The Difference Techtarget While network redundancy is an all or nothing approach to provide continuous network operation, network resilience is the recovery from smaller system faults on a single network device or between devices without needing duplicate hardware and software. Each has a different job to perform: redundancy means having duplicate parts of a system so that another is ready to take over if one part fails. resiliency is a system's ability to recover quickly from challenges, adapt to changes, and continue working despite disruptions.
